AI summary

Newtime Infrastructure Limited reported audited financial results for FY25 showing a sharp swing into losses. On a standalone basis, revenue from operations fell to Rs. 336.25 lakhs from Rs. 755 lakhs in FY24 (a drop of about 55%), and the company posted a net loss of Rs. 181.58 lakhs compared to a profit of Rs. 197.98 lakhs last year. On a consolidated basis, revenue declined to Rs. 516.47 lakhs (from Rs. 741.94 lakhs), with a net loss of Rs. 308.12 lakhs against a profit of Rs. 793.31 lakhs in FY24, partly aided last year by a Rs. 632.21 lakh exceptional item. The auditor (Chatterjee & Chatterjee) issued an unqualified opinion but highlighted an emphasis of matter noting that certain immovable properties and shares have been provisionally attached by the Enforcement Directorate under the Prevention of Money Laundering Act, with financial impact not ascertainable. The Secretarial Compliance Report flagged multiple delayed filings with BSE, including a Rs. 1.08 lakh fine, and the company's shares remain suspended on the stock exchange.

Likely market impact

Shareholders should note the steep revenue decline, return to losses, and the serious Enforcement Directorate attachment on company assets — a regulatory overhang whose financial impact is still unclear. Compliance lapses and the ongoing trading suspension add further risk to the stock.
